§ 385B.070 — Rules and regulations to include criteria for staging of all-star game and participation of all-star team

The rules and regulations adopted by the Nevada Interscholastic Activities Association pursuant to NRS 385B.060 must provide criteria to be used by the Association when determining whether to approve or disapprove:
1.The staging of an all-star game, contest or meet by any other organization; and
2.The participation of an all-star team in a game, contest or meet regardless of whether the game, contest or meet is approved by any other organization.

Legislative History
(Added to NRS by 2013, 538 )—(Substituted in revision for NRS 386.433)
